if (HAL_UARTEx_ReceiveToIdle(&huart1, buffer,100, &size, HAL_MAX_DELAY)==HAL_OK)
{
HAL_UART_Transmit(&huart1, buffer, size, HAL_MAX_DELAY);
}
这是实现串口发送收到返回的
int fputc(int ch, FILE *f)
{
HAL_UART_Transmit(&huart1, (uint8_t *)&ch, 1, 1000);
return ch;
}
printf
8962

被折叠的 条评论
为什么被折叠?



